Transaction 72556e8a4b32dfec07b4e2316525f4fb283017ad18000b716130de0f5e15457a

2 Input
2 Outputs
  • 72556e8a4b32dfec07b4e2316525f4fb283017ad18000b716130de0f5e15457a:0
  • value  5528500
    address  12fF9qCSiCMTUW4dcK3QRkHNCp9fHY8tum
  • 72556e8a4b32dfec07b4e2316525f4fb283017ad18000b716130de0f5e15457a:1
  • value  438797
    address  39wEyo3nYR9e43PGzha74vKFHMi6coBi3Z